This 2-bedroom, 1-bath unit is ideally located in the heart of Milton, offering convenient access to HWY 90, as well as nearby shops, restaurants and stores. Situated in a duplex, the unit features a spacious, open backyard perfect for outdoor enjoyment. Inside, you'll find tiled floors throughout and an updated kitchen equipped with a stove and refrigerator. Tenants are responsible for utilities and there are no washer/dryer hookups. No pets allowed. Residents are required to have renter liability insurance, which can be added for $11.95/month or you can opt into the Resident Benefits Package (rbp) for $45/month, which includes renter liability insurance, HVAC air filter delivery and on-demand pest control. This property is also accepting Santa Rosa County housing vouchers and is available for immediate move-in.
